In Utah, the dry climate and significant temperature variations between seasons are key factors in paver patio construction. Proper sub-base preparation, including adequate compaction and drainage, is crucial to prevent issues related to ground expansion and contraction during freeze-thaw cycles. Installing pavers during the spring or fall, when temperatures are moderate, allows for optimal base setting and paver placement without the stress of extreme heat or the risk of working on frozen ground. Summer installations require careful attention to prevent premature drying of base materials.

What is the best time of year to lay pavers in Utah?

The most favorable times for laying pavers in Utah are during the spring and fall. These seasons offer moderate temperatures that are ideal for preparing the base and laying pavers without the challenges of extreme summer heat or winter frost. This ensures proper compaction and stability for the patio.

Is it cheaper to do a paver patio or concrete in West Valley City?

When comparing paver patios and concrete in West Valley City, pavers may have a higher initial cost due to the detailed base preparation and individual unit placement. However, concrete can be prone to cracking and heaving in Utah's climate, potentially leading to more significant repair expenses over time. Pavers offer greater flexibility and easier repair of individual units.

What are the permitting requirements for paver patios in Utah?

Permitting for paver patios in Utah can vary by local jurisdiction. Projects that are larger in scale or involve significant changes to drainage may require a permit. Homeowners in areas like Provo should consult their local building department to understand specific regulations before starting their installation.
